How do I rid my home of mold or mildew odor?
Charcoal and/or baking soda can be used to remove the odor of mold, if the treatment has not done so. Simply place briquettes and/or bowls of baking soda in the area to absorb odor. Do not try to wipe away mold with charcoal or baking soda. What general strategies can I use to avoid molds? Avoid exposure to mold in damp places such as wooded areas, barns, basements, and saunas. Wear a tight-fitting face mask if you cant avoid moldy places. Dont use humidifiers and vaporizers because they will increase humidity in the room and create a favorable environment for mold growth. If you must use a humidifier, clean it daily to prevent mold growth. Change water in the dehumidifier frequently, and clean the dehumidifier often. Paint damp areas with mold-inhibiting paint. Remove stuff mold tends to grow on: old musty books, plants, mildewed carpets. Spray rooms with air conditioners with mold killing sprays if they begin to smell musty.
